Foil-printed fabric is a specialty textile featuring a metallic foil layer bonded to a base fabric, typically polyester or cotton, creating a striking visual effect and texture.

About Foil-Printed Fabric

This fabric is constructed by applying a thin layer of metallic foil onto a base fabric, often through a heat transfer process. The foil can be applied in various patterns, resulting in a shiny, reflective surface that enhances the aesthetic appeal of garments and accessories. The base fabric provides structural integrity and comfort, while the foil layer adds a unique visual element. Common applications include evening wear, costumes, and fashion accessories.

Care Instructions

Machine wash cold on a gentle cycle. Do not bleach. Iron on low heat on the reverse side to avoid damaging the foil.

Additional Information

Foil-printed fabric can be sensitive to heat and abrasion, so care should be taken during washing and ironing. The foil layer may wear off over time with heavy use.
